Abstract
With the more and more ubiquitous nature of the Social networks and Cloud computing, users are establishing to explore new ways to interact with exploit these setting up paradigms. Despite the fact that many pricing schemes in IaaS platform are already proposed with the pay as you go and the subscriptions pot market policy to guarantee carrier level contract, it’s still inevitable undergo from wasteful fee due to the fact of coarse grained pricing scheme. On this paper, we examine an optimized first-rate grained and fair pricing scheme. These are two rough issues are addressed: (i)The gains of useful resource vendors and patrons most often contradict together. (ii) VM -protection overhead like startup price is most likely too enormous to be neglected. Now not best we can derive an best price in the desirable cost variety that satisfies both purchasers and vendors at the same time, we additionally discover a quality match billing cycle to maximize social welfare
